If you feel as if you have lost interest in life, or feel sad and listless for more than a few weeks, you could be showing signs of depression. Clinical depression occurs when these feelings start to affect your usual routine.
Some studies suggest about 16 per cent of the population will suffer from depression at sometime in their lives. Depression can affect anyone of any age or sex. Women are about four times more likely than men to become depressed. Male depression can often come across as anger and hostility. Child and teen depression often shows up as disruptive behavior or a loss of interest in school or favorite pass times.
Some people may mistake the signs of depression in elderly people as the normal aging process. Seniors may be going through a number of changes in their lives, such as the loss of a life long partner, or illness. Sometimes seniors are lonely, and embarrassed to talk about how they feel.
New mothers can suffer the effects of post partum depression. This usually occurs within the first year of giving birth. Post partum depression makes it difficult for the new mom to bond with her baby. Almost every new mom experiences the blues shortly after delivery, but this feeling goes away within a few days. Post partum depression is more severe and lasting.
Signs of depression may start to appear in people who have recently experienced a trauma. The physical weakness and stress that accompany a serious illness such as heart disease or major injury can trigger depression. The stress of depression can make recovering more challenging.
If you have recently gone through some changes in your life, you may be more prone to depression. Someone who is newly divorced or unemployed can be susceptible. Even changing jobs, retiring or moving to a new community can start the cycle of negative feelings.
The signs of depression can vary from person to person. You may feel like sleeping all the time, or you may have trouble sleeping. You may feel exhausted and drained for no reason. Your eating habits can also change. Perhaps you’re hungry all the time, or maybe you have no appetite.
If you are depressed, you may also feel stress and anxiety. You could be easily irritated or restless. You may feel guilt and embarrassment. Loss of interest in previously enjoyable activities and hobbies could be a sign of depression. Your ability to reason and think clearly might deteriorate. You could even feel hopeless and worthless.
Sometimes depression can show up as physical pain. People with depression may feel weakness, joint pain, abdominal cramps, or headaches. Sometimes depression can be present along with other mood disorders such as social phobias or obsessive compulsiveness. You may start to depend on drugs or alcohol to make you feel better.
Your doctor or another health professional can help determine if you are showing signs of depression. People with depression sometimes think they will never feel better. They may even consider hurting or killing themselves. But there is treatment, and you can start to feel better.
Take the first step and talk to someone about how you feel. A friend or family member can help. Or call your doctor, hospital, or local crisis line. You can recover from depression.
